Why the answer is C, and why the others tempt you.
To convert from Celsius to Kelvin, the formula is K = °C + 273. Therefore, 25°C + 273 = 298 K. Option A results from subtracting 273 instead of adding, option B is just 273 (forgetting to add 25), and option D results from adding 300 instead of 273.
